    My Samsung RL33SBNS is flashing the four outer lights on and off and wont seem to switch on – presume this is some kind of error code – can anyone translate it?

    It was making some noise and there was ice in the freezer, so I defrosted it thoroughly and switched it back on and it wouldnt start, just the flashing lights.

    I checked all the connections internally in case there was a sensor loose or something – all seem ok visiyally. It has suffered from frosting up over the last three years, but usually a good defrost sorts it all out.

    I found a manual online and it indicates that this combination of flashing lights indicate that it’s a freezer temp sensor malfunction.

    Relatively cheap to replace, so I will try that and see if normal service is resumed.
